  • Euroopas ning mitmel pool mujal maailmas jätkuvad pühad pärssisid esmaspäeval aktiivsust ka Ühendriikide aktsiaturul, mida ostjad suutsid vaatamata pehmematele majandusnäitajatele ning maksureformi võimalikust edasilükkumisest hoiatanud USA rahandusministrile enda kasuks tööle panna. S&P 500 indeks sulgus 0,9% kõrgemal, kosudes osaliselt eelmise nädala langusest.

    Ühendriikide majade ehitajate kindlustunde indeks alanes aprillis oodatud ühe punkti asemel kolme punkti võrra 68 punktile, kuid arvestades eelneva kuu kuuepunktilist hüpet 12a kõrgeimale tasemele, püsib kindlustunne ajalooliselt endiselt väga kõrgena. Küsitlust läbiviiva NAHB juhi Granger MacDonali sõnul püsib nõudlus uute majade vastu kõrgena, kuid ehitajad seisavad silmitsi nii materjalide kallinemise kui ka mahukate regulatiivsete kuludega, mille vähendamist Trumpi administratsioonilt oodatakse.



    USA töötleva tööstuse aprilli esimese regionaalse küsitluse kohaselt kasvas New Yorki osariigis aktiivsus tagasihoidlikumalt kui märtsis. NY FEDi küsitlusel põhinev äritingimuste indeks alanes aprillis 11,2 punkti võrra 5,2 punktile (oodati 15,0) ning uute tellimuste indeksi järsk taandumine (21,3 punktilt 7,0 punktile) viitab tagasihoidlikuma kasvu jätkumisele. Sellest hoolimata muutusid ettevõtted järgneva kuue kuu väljavaate osas optimistlikumaks, mis aitas hoida palkamisaktiivsust sektoris robustsena ning tõsta kapitaliinvesteeringute indeksit nelja punkti võrra 27,7 punktile, saavutades kõrgeima taseme rohkem kui kahe aasta jooksul.

    Nädala makrokalender püsib USA-kesksena, kui täna saavad fookuses olema kinnisvaraturu märtsi esimesed näitajad (ehitusload ning alustatud elamuehitused) ning tööstustoodang. Ettevõtetest avaldavad oma tulemused enne turgude avanemist Bank of America, Charles Schwab, Goldman Sachs, Harley-Davidson, Johnson & Johnson, UnitedHealth ning järelkauplemise ajal IBM ja Yahoo!.

  • Euroopa aktsiafondid on näinud viimastel nädalatel kapitali tagasivoolu, mis on siiski veel köömes võrreldes eelmise aasta väljavooluga

    * Europe equity funds see inflows of $1.8b in the week to April 12, largest in 68 weeks, BofAML strategists write in note, citing EPFR Global data.
    * Europe funds have seen $4.2b inflows in past three weeks, but follows $90.9b of outflows in prior year
    * Expected surge of inflows awaits confirmation that French presidential election second-round is not Melenchon-Le Pen; benign French election expected to induce U.S. flows to Europe and expectations of tightening by ECB later in 2017
    * U.S. equity funds see inflows of $0.4b; emerging markets stocks see inflows of $2.1b
    * By sector: inflows to tech, financials, consumer, health care, utilities; outflows from materials, energy, real estate
    * In fixed income: bonds overall see inflows of $6.1b, with inflows in 15 of the last 16 weeks; IG bond funds see $1.9b inflows, HY bond funds see $0.4b outflows; emerging market debt see inflows of $2.7b

  • IMF RAISES OUTLOOK FOR 2017 GLOBAL GROWTH ON JAPAN, U.K., CHINA
    IMF WEO Raises Global Growth Forecasts To 3.5% (3.4%) For 2017 & Sees 2018 At 3.6%
    IMF raises China growth forecast to 6.6% this year, 6.2% in 2018
    IMF hikes UK 2017 GDP growth forecast to 2.0% from 1.5%
    IMF KEEPS U.S. 2017 GROWTH EST. AT 2.3%; 2018 EST. STAYS 2.5%
    IMF Hikes 2017 Euro-Area Growth To 2.3% From 1.5% In Oct 2016
    IMF WEO: Global Trade Is Showing Some Signs Of Recovery After A Long Period Of Weakness
